--- title: Reasoning subtitle: Configure reasoning parsers for models that emit thinking content --- Some models emit reasoning or thinking content separately from their final response. Dynamo can split that output into `reasoning_content` and normal assistant content by configuring `--dyn-reasoning-parser` on the backend worker. ## Prerequisites To enable reasoning parsing, launch the backend worker with: - `--dyn-reasoning-parser`: select the reasoning parser from the supported list below ```bash # can be sglang, trtllm, vllm, etc. based on your installation python -m dynamo. --help ``` Some models need both a reasoning parser and a tool call parser. For supported tool call parser names, see [Tool Calling](/dynamo/dev/user-guides/tool-calling). ## Supported Reasoning Parsers The reasoning parser names currently supported in the codebase are: | Parser Name | Typical Models / Format | |-------------|-------------------------| | `basic` | Generic `...` reasoning blocks | | `deepseek_r1` | Models that should treat output as reasoning until `` is seen, such as `deepseek-ai/DeepSeek-R1` style responses | | `glm45` | `zai-org/GLM-4.5` and GLM-5 style `...` reasoning blocks | | `gpt_oss` | `openai/gpt-oss-*` | | `granite` | Granite models that emit `Here's my thought process:` / `Here's my response:` markers | | `kimi` | Kimi models that emit `◁think▷...◁/think▷` | | `kimi_k25` | `moonshotai/Kimi-K2.5*` models that require force-reasoning handling for `...` | | `minimax_append_think` | MiniMax models that begin reasoning immediately and effectively need an implicit opening `` tag prepended | | `mistral` | Mistral reasoning models that emit `[THINK]...[/THINK]` | | `nemotron_deci` | Nemotron models that emit standard `...` reasoning blocks | | `nemotron_nano` | Nemotron Nano reasoning output that ends with `` without requiring a visible opening tag | | `qwen3` | `Qwen/Qwen3-*` style `...` responses | | `step3` | Step-style models that should treat content as reasoning until `` is seen | ## Common Parser Pairings Some models need both parsers configured together. Common pairings include: - `openai/gpt-oss-*`: `--dyn-tool-call-parser harmony --dyn-reasoning-parser gpt_oss` - `zai-org/GLM-4.7`: `--dyn-tool-call-parser glm47 --dyn-reasoning-parser glm45` - `moonshotai/Kimi-K2.5*`: `--dyn-tool-call-parser kimi_k2 --dyn-reasoning-parser kimi_k25` - MiniMax M2.1 style outputs: `--dyn-tool-call-parser minimax_m2 --dyn-reasoning-parser minimax_append_think` ## Tool Calling Interplay Reasoning parsing happens before tool call parsing. If a model emits both reasoning content and tool calls, configure both parsers so Dynamo can first separate reasoning text and then parse tool calls from the remaining assistant output.
